To completely understand this quilt, you need to understand the story behind it. <br />
<br />
Last year when I talked to my son at Christmas, he mentioned that he was sleeping with 2 half blankets. One across his legs and the other across his torso. He is 6'3" by the way. I of course asked if he would like to have a quilt and he said that it'd be nice. So I started right away making a quilt for him. It had to be manly and to find a pattern and fabric that was manly was not an easy task. I was finally able to find one I liked <a href="http://www.quiltville.com/bricksandstones.shtml">here.</a> Then it was off to find the fabric. I started collecting greens and browns and it finally came together. The entire time I was working on it, I told myself I was making him a "whole" quilt and so the name of this quilt naturally became <br />
